You may need to suppress system 7's urge to rebuild a system 6 desktop (if that's what's happening; couldn't tell for sure from your description, so sorry if I have it backwards). The easiest way to accomplish this is to install DesktopMgr in the system 6 system folder (and ONLY in that folder; do NOT install in the system 7 system folder).

No, I think you've got it kinda backwards, thanks to my fantastic description tactics. I'll try and lay it out better:

SE is the client, it has system 6.0.8 and appleshare workstation (client) 3.5. Plugged into the printer serial port is a mac serial cable running to my quadra 700's printer serial port.

The 700 is running 7.6.1 and has three 1.5GB HDD partitions, appletalk is set to use the printer port and file sharing is enabled.

On the SE, if I go to the chooser and click apple share it lists the quadra no problem and then lists all the connected drives. If I try and connect to any one of them (including mounted CD-ROMs) the SE displays a message saying that the disk needs minor repairs, press ok to do them or cancel to cancel. When I hit ok it gives an error that it isn't possible, and when I hit cancel it just loops the window, and I have to press the reset button.
